其实很简单
1、h5中调用uni.postMessage会报错 2、h5中调用navigateBack,如果当前页面就是webview嵌的首页,它只会刷新当前页,不会回到app的上一页 看文档上是需要下载 uni.webview.1.5.4.js 将该js放在static目录下 关键代码如下 这样就可以正常返回app的上一页,wx.miniProgram.navigateBack则是在小程序的webview中返回小程...
解决了么
1. 2. 3. 4. 2,在h5页面调用: html 点击返回 1. js document.addEventListener('UniAppJSBridgeReady',function() { document.querySelector('.btn').addEventListener('click', function(evt) { uni.navigateBack()//sdk中默认如果没有参数,则delta为1 }); }); 1. 2. 3. 4. 5. 6. 7. 8...
最近uniapp嵌入了一个h5页面,需要通过页面上的按钮返回。 uni官方文档上这样描述,<web-view>加载的h5网页中,是支持调用以下api的: 但是在实际h5页面中,直接调用这些方法并不起作用。 百度了一圈,原来,h5页面中需要引入以下两个sdk。分为以下步骤: 1,在h5页面引入SDK。注意:两个都要引入,其中任意一个不引入都...
结论:app端支持比较好可以做到实时传递,微信小程序支持比较差,小程序向url传参只能通过url,url向app传参需要特定时机(后退、组件销毁、分享、复制链接)触发才能收到消息。 以下是代码 app端(需要使用nvue) <template> <view class="webview-box"> 点击向url传值 <web-view ref="webview" class="webview" src...
uniapp实现小程序和内嵌webView的互通 webView传递消息到小程序 1、首先在自己的vue H5项目中添加shops.html 不管是不是uni 的H5,都需要引入这个uni 的sdk 1. <!DOCTYPE html> <%= htmlWebpackPlugin.options.title %> <!-- Open Graph data --> <!-- ...
问题描述 问题一: 页面由 小程序A页面 -> web-viewA页面 -> 小程序B页面 , 在由 小程序B页面 返回至(点击左上角返回按钮 / 手势右划返回) web-viewA页面 , 出现 http://about 不是业务域名提示. 复现步骤 [ 华为 ] : Mate10Pro & P30 , 详见 ↓ url 视频 https://v.qq.com/x
uniapp⼩程序之webview嵌⼊h5页⾯,从h5页⾯返回⼩程序最近uniapp嵌⼊了⼀个h5页⾯,需要通过页⾯上的按钮返回。uni官⽅⽂档上这样描述,<web-view>加载的h5⽹页中,是⽀持调⽤以下api的:但是在实际h5页⾯中,直接调⽤这些⽅法并不起作⽤。百度了⼀圈,原来,h5页⾯中需要...